Sergey A. Bursakov is a scholar working on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Molecular Biology and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Sergey A. Bursakov has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 990 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, 12 papers in Molecular Biology and 8 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Sergey A. Bursakov’s work include Metalloenzymes and iron-sulfur proteins (13 papers), Enzyme Structure and Function (8 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(4 papers). Sergey A. Bursakov is often cited by papers focused on Metalloenzymes and iron-sulfur proteins (13 papers), Enzyme Structure and Function (8 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(4 papers). Sergey A. Bursakov coll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, Spain and Russia. Sergey A. Bursakov's co-authors include Isabel Moura, José J. G. Moura, Juan J. Calvete, Maria João Romão, João M.L. Dias, Robert Huber, Jorge Caldeira, C. Carneiro, Graham N. George and Gleb Bourenkov and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, PLoS ONE and Biochemistry.
